JOURNALISTIC ETHICS
Explore the vital concepts of accountability and integrity in the media with Journalistic Ethics by Dale Jacquette, published by Taylor & Francis in 2019. This insightful book delves into the moral rights and responsibilities of journalists, emphasizing the importance of truth-telling in the public interest. With a compelling collection of 31 case studies drawn from contemporary journalistic practices, Journalistic Ethics illustrates the real-world implications of ethical decision-making for both journalists and their audiences.
